Longo: Milan planning to delay Gabbia renewal until 2025 – the reason why

Matteo Gabbia should be given a new contract shortly, according to recent reports. However, there has been a suggestion that AC Milan will delay the deal until next year.

Since the start of the year, there has not been a more consistent performer for Milan than Gabbia. When he returned from Villarreal, he took his opportunity when given, and quickly became a mainstay. However, things looked bleak when the Rossoneri added another defender in the summer mercato.

Now, though, his position in the defence could not be stronger, and he is the first-choice for Paulo Fonseca after some vital performances, including a huge goal in the derby. It is not just the Diavolo who are noticing the 24-year-old, and when he was given his first senior Italian National Team call-up it was not a surprise.

With his performances, and importance growing, Milan have been keen to discuss a new contract with the defender, and things are going positively, according to reports. At present, it is believed the parties are working on a five-year deal.

However, Daniele Longo has reported that the contract may not be finalised until January 2025, and this would be done strategically, with the intention of changing the expiry date to June 2030.
